I had the same situation as you - I had 9 options and they have to choose one out of two possible answers...I made a table just for aesthetics. Essentially column 1 are my factors, and column 2 they have to select one of the two shapes, This is a pick many free form quiz option. So I selected all the shapes in the free form, and just put a check mark beside the one that must be correct and told the user they must select all before clicking submit. And told them to click again to deactivate. So user does have to read instructions. Seems to work. Just did it this morning in 360. I put in a one slide to show. I know your post is a year old, but sometimes you are still plugging away looking for a solution the next time. I also changed the look of the selected state on the buttons so the user can tell they activated it.
